With the continuing emergence of new technologies and our subsequent reliance on them, more and more of our daily activities take place online, such as shopping, filing taxes, booking a hotel and paying bills. Have you ever considered what would happen if some of this information fell into someone else’s hands? It is now more important than ever to make sure all our information is being protected. Before you finalize that Amazon purchase or submit that electric bill, pause to consider the following steps to help you stay protected:

  • Utilize strong passwords. A strong password should:
    • Be at least eight characters long;
    • Not contain your username, real name or any other personal information;
    • Not be a complete word; and
    • Include u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ers and special characters.
  • Make sure everything is updated. Make sure you:
    • Install hardware and software updates periodically;
    • Ensure all anti-virus and anti-malware software is updated;
    • Check for Chrome, Internet Explorer, Safari and/or Firefox updates; and
    • Consistently back up your information.
